Bathroom Drywalling in Littleton, CO
Bathroom drywalling services encompass the installation, repair, and finishing of drywall surfaces within bathrooms to create smooth, durable walls suitable for painting or tiling. These services are often requested for new bathroom construction, remodeling projects, or to repair damage caused by moisture, leaks, or general wear and tear. Property owners typically seek drywalling to achieve a clean, polished look that enhances the overall appearance of the space, while also ensuring the walls are properly prepared for final finishes.
Before requesting bathroom drywalling, property owners should consider the scope of the project, including whether the work involves installing new drywall, replacing existing panels, or repairing water-damaged areas. It’s also helpful to understand the specific requirements for moisture-resistant drywall, especially in areas exposed to high humidity such as showers and tubs. Clarifying project details and desired finishes can help ensure the drywalling process meets expectations and results in a long-lasting, attractive bathroom interior.

Bathroom Drywalling Questions
What types of bathroom drywalling projects are common? Typical projects include wall repairs, new installations, and remodeling to improve bathroom aesthetics and functionality.
Is moisture-resistant drywall necessary in bathrooms? Yes, moisture-resistant drywall helps prevent mold and water damage in humid bathroom environments.
How should bathroom drywall be prepared before installation? Surfaces should be clean, dry, and free of debris to ensure proper adhesion and finish.
What finishes are available for bathroom drywall surfaces? Common finishes include smooth, textured, or waterproof coatings to match the bathroom design.
